Quote:
Originally Posted by Sonic0075
If you get the extended maintenance program, does it cover more of the "wear and tear" items? I thought that is what I was told. I need another beer
Yes, that is precisely the definition of the maintenance program, replacement of wear and tear items. There are at least two distinct maintenance programs:
  • Scheduled maintenance replaces scheduled items such as filters that are programmed to be changed at a certain date or mileage.
  • Full maintance replaces all wear items, which includes things such as wiper blades and brake pads.
The confusion results from the fact that many mistakenly refer to the maintenance program as a warranty, when it isn't a warranty program in any sense, it is just prepaid service work.
